Conflict Resolution

Do you have conflicts at within your organization? Are turf wars, conflicts, disagreements, and differences of opinion escalating into interpersonal conflict.  If so, you must intervene immediately. Mediated conflict resolution is essential.  Unfortunately, few  individuals are trained to mediate conflict between others.  Additionally, "in house" mediators are often seen as being partial to one side or another.  Third party mediators, especially if mutually agreed upon by the warring factions, often have more credibility.

Team Building

Team building is designed for groups who want to improve the working relationships between individual members.  Activities are designed to foster personal awareness, understanding, sensitivity, communication skills, conflict resolution, and problem solving skills. 

People in every workplace talk about building the team, working as a team, and my team, but few understand how to create the experience of team work or how to develop an effective team. Belonging to a team, in the broadest sense, is a result of feeling part of something larger than yourself. It has a lot to do with your understanding of the mission or objectives of your organization.

In a team-oriented environment, you contribute to the overall success of the organization. You work with fellow members of the organization to produce these results. Even though you have a specific job function and you belong to a specific department, you are unified with other organization members to accomplish the overall objectives. The bigger picture drives your actions; your function exists to serve the collective goals of the organization.

You need to differentiate this overall sense of teamwork from the task of developing an effective intact team that is formed to accomplish a specific goal. People confuse the two team building objectives. This is why so many team building seminars, meetings, retreats, and activities are deemed failures by their participants. Leaders failed to define the team they wanted to build. Developing an overall sense of team work is different from building an effective, focused work team when you consider team building approaches.
